Many people feel that they will be going against nature if they stop eating salt or even cut
down a little. Researchers feel that we consume enough amounts
of salt naturally just from the foods that we eat. We don't need to add any more!
The average person gets about four teaspoons of salt every day but we only need about a
quarter teaspoon.
Salt is an acquired taste. If you grew up consuming very salty foods, then it will take
time to re-train your brain to realize that you do not need to add salt to your meals.
Drink plenty of water to replace the water that is lost if you sweat a lot. This is very
important.
It is also recommended to increase your potassium levels to help balance out the fluid levels
in your body.
6 Benefits of Reducing your Sodium Intake and Lower Your Blood Pressure. Keep a tracker
similar to the one below:
Step 1: Record all the foods that you eat every day. This will be beneficial when you
have a doctor's visit
Step 2: Measure the amount of salt that you consume each day. Take the salt shaker off
the table.
Don't add salt to your food before tasting it. This is a habit! Think about it!
Step 3: Do not add salt when you are cooking. Try to add low sodium spices instead
Step 4: Read the labels when you are shopping and choose low sodium products and meals
Step 5: Add more fruits and vegetables to your diet. This is a better choice compared
to packaged snacks
Step 6: Be aware when you are dining out. Ask for meals that are prepared without salt
We suggest that you consult with your doctor to find out how reducing your sodium intake
may lower your blood pressure
